If x= 0, 1, 2, and 3 and y=1, 1.5, 2, and 2.5, then what is the "y=" function?

The values are increasing equally so it's a linear function.
The formula is [tex]y=mx+b[/tex]
For [tex]x=0[/tex], [tex]y=1[/tex] so [tex]b=1[/tex] (y-intercept).
Take some point and put its coordinates into the equation to find [tex]m[/tex] (slope).
[tex]2=m\cdot2+1\\ 2m=1\\ m=\dfrac{1}{2}\\\\ \boxed{y=\dfrac{1}{2}x+1}[/tex]
